1 / 36 page ![]() Features • Quasi-Resonant (QR) topology • Primary side regulation of output voltage • Direct optocoupler connection for secondary side regulated loop • High power factor and low THD in universal and extended range (PF> 0.9 and THD < 5% @ full load and < 10% @ 1/3 load) • 800 V fast high-voltage startup • Extremely low input power at no-load and standby conditions • Integrated input voltage detection for high power factor capabilty, DC rail detection and protection triggering • Programmable frequency foldback with valley locking for noise free operation • Programmable maximum input power limitation for safety standard compliancy • Programmable brownout and input overvoltage protection • Latch-free device guarantee by smart Auto Restart Timer (ART) • Input pin for remote protection with NTC management (threshold hysteresis and linearization) Application • Single-stage LED drivers with high power factor up to 180 W • Two-stage LED drivers up to 200 W Description The HVLED101 is an enhanced peak current mode controller able to control mainly high power factor (HPF) flyback or buck-boost topologies having an output power up to 180 W. Some other topologies, like buck, boost and SEPIC could also be implemented. Primary Side Regulation of output voltage and Optocoupler control can be applied independently on the chip both exploiting precise regulation and very low standby power during no-load conditions. The innovative ST high-voltage technology allows to directly connect the HVLED101 to the input voltage in order to both start up the device and monitor the input voltage without the need of external components. Integrated valley locking feature guarantees noise free operation during medium and low load operation and maximum power control allows limiting the input power to a level programmable by the user to increase converter safety. Abnormal conditions like open circuit, output short-circuit, input overvoltage or undervoltage, external protection circuitries and circuit failures like open loop and overcurrent of the main switch are effectively controlled. A smart Auto Restart Timer (ART) function is built in to guarantee an automatic application recover, without any loss of reliability.
